CHICAGO SOUTHLAND CHAMBER OF COMMERCE 1916 W. 174th St., East Hazel Crest Additional information: Tom Hall, Chairman of the Board (708) 957-6950 Chamber speaker tackles survival, stability, success Business leaders continue to intensify the search for survival techniques in an unforgiving economy, one that dispenses new challenges each day. Indeed, financial stability has become paramount. With her decades of corporate success and experience, Laura Malke knows what works. On Jan. 12, the Chicago Southland Chamber of Commerce opens its 2009 Regional Consensus Luncheon series with Malke as keynote speaker. Now CEO of her own company, Frankfort-based Strategic Solutions & Services, Inc., the former executive who participated in several acquisitions and mergers within major corporations -- including Hewlett-Packard and G.E. Capital -- will examine “roadmaps to success.” The self-described “business coach” and strategist brings her corporate survival techniques to small companies with anywhere from one to 200 employees. She states unequivocally every business leader should have a “roadmap to success.” “If you don’t have a business plan, you are not going to reach your ultimate goals,” she says. “If you don’t have that roadmap, you’re putting your business, employees, clients and even vendors at risk.” Backup strategies become critical in economic downturns.The first step in formulating a plan, she says, is to “identify key metrics. Once you have measurements, you can start to distinguish” what works and where there is a potential or existing challenge, she says.
